Who News: 50th Anniversary Biopic Announced

Journey on An Adventure In Time And Space next year!
Mark Gatiss will pen a new drama chronicling the inception of Doctor Who in time for the show's fiftieth anniversary, the BBC have confirmed today. Pitched as a biography-picture, the one-off 90 minute special An Adventure In Time And Space will focus on iconic staplemates of the series such as Verity Lambert and Sydney Newman while depicting the process with which the show was conceived and the early challenges its writers and producers had to overcome. This progrmame will form but one of plenty of celebratory anniversary events next year, with multiple special episodes of Who already planned to lead up to November 23rd, 2013 and more widespread events no doubt taking shape in the minds of the show's current marketing team. "This is the story of how an unlikely set of brilliant people created a true television original," says writer Gatiss, "And how an actor- William Hartnell- stereotyped in hard-man roles became a hero to millions of children. I've wanted to tell this story for more years than I can remember! To make it happen for Doctor Who's 50th Anniversary is simply a dream come true." More details on production, casting and broadcast scheduling will be confirmed early next year. An Adventure In Time And Space airs on BBC2 in 2013, while Doctor Who returns for its new run on September 1st.
